RB1 loss triggers dependence on ESRRG in retinoblastoma
19 Aug 2022
Abstract excerpt
Retinoblastoma (Rb) is a deadly childhood eye cancer that is classically initiated by inactivation of the RB1 tumor suppressor. Clinical management continues to rely on nonspecific chemotherapeutic agents that are associated with treatment resistance and toxicity.
